#30705: Django template permissions not working when used inside the template of an inclusion tag -+- Reporter: erev0s |Owner: nobody Type: Bug | Status: closed Component: Template system | Version: 2.2 Severity: Normal | Resolution: invalid Keywords: permissions, | Triage Stage: inclusion tag | Unreviewed Has patch: 0| Needs documentation: 0 Needs tests: 0| Patch needs improvement: 0 Easy pickings: 0|UI/UX: 0 -+- Changes (by Carlton Gibson): * status: new => closed * resolution: => invalid Comment: The block is not rendered because `perms` is not present in the context of your inclusion tag, so the conditional correctly evaluates to `False`. Take a look at the [https://docs.djangoproject.com/en/2.2/howto/custom- template-tags/#inclusion-tags Inclusion tags] docs. You'll need to use the `takes_context` kwarg and pass a reference to `perms` as per the examples there. I recommend investigating [https://django-debug- toolbar.readthedocs.io/en/latest/index.html Django Debug Toolbar] to see exactly what templates are rendered, with exactly what contexts. #30705: Django template permissions not working when used inside the template of an inclusion tag -+- Reporter: erev0s | Owner: nobody Type: | Status: new Uncategorized | Component: Template |Version: 2.2 system | Keywords: permissions, Severity: Normal | inclusion tag Triage Stage: | Has patch: 0 Unreviewed | Needs documentation: 0 |Needs tests: 0 Patch needs improvement: 0 | Easy pickings: 0 UI/UX: 0 | -+- I have 2 apps in a Django Project i am using to learn django. In the app A I have an inclusion tag where I am using a template named `templateA.html`. This inclusion tag is being used in the app B, inside the template `templateB.html`. The content of `templateA.html` is shown properly inside `templateB.html`. I noticed though that when I am attempting to check permissions of the user using code similar to the following: {{{ {% if perms.appA.can_do_something %} show something here {% endif %} }}} then, if I include that code in `templateA.html` it is not working, while if I use it in `templateB.html` it is working properly. I am mentioning again that the `templateA.html` is the one used in the inclusion tag I am using in the `templateB.html`. -- Ticket URL: <https://code.djangoproject.com/ticket/30705> Django <https://code.djangoproject.com/> The Web framework for perfectionists with deadlines. -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"Django updates" group.
